The original demo of the classic song "Moon River" - made famous in the film "Breakfast at Tiffany's" - has been released to the ÃÛÑ¿´«Ã½ by the widow of Henry Mancini, who wrote the music. In the recording, Mancini plays the tune on the piano, while the lyricist, Johnny Mercer, sings the words. The full score of the song is to be performed at London's Royal Albert Hall.
